WLAN in D630 latitude

i have just fitted a WLAN card in my D630 latitude (windows xp prof) and cannonot get drivers for it. Dell part number OPC193. How do I down load drivers for it?

That's a Intel® PRO/Wireless 3945ABG Network Card (Tri-mode 802.11a/b/g)

Look at the intel site for drivers

The intel driver set seems to have a flaw in low signal conditions.

In all it works ok

As much as I like Intel, I find the pro set software is too much "in your face". If you find this the case also, you can go to add remove programs in the control panel, find the intel proset, I think you click on uninstall or update... not sure which. You will get a listing, edit the designators to the left of each listing so they show and "X " except for the drivers then click continue. Then reboot ,  once back in windows  go to the network applet in control panel, right click your wireless card, click properties, select the middle tab wireless, check the box "let windows configure your network" do not do anything else, click ok or apply close,  use the icon in the icon tray to view wireless networks or go back into the network aplet...also make sure the box is checked " show network in notification area when connected"
